my block

6 bolt n't block

polished crank

acl bearings?

manhley rods and pistons (i think 30 over)

balance shafts removed. stubby shaft used.

line bore and hone with arp stus

arp head studs.

mitsu head gasket.

Here's the issue

under high rpm and high load there is a wobbling (maybe a thudding sound would descrinbed better). usually on the highway, passing. ( i do that a lot)

other than that, the motor runs and sounds awesome.

now my machinist ruled out the out of balance of the rotating assembly because it is intermittent.

I have already replaced the harmonic dampner with one I had lying around, with no effect.

I suspect the tensioner is going, or the stubby shaft is dancing around. most likely the tensioner.


any thoughts??
